Convert PROC's to GUI

Fort Lauderdale, Florida June 11, 2006
Binary Star Development Corporation, the makers of the Nucleus Environment, announced a break through today in a converter, being able to convert PROC's or stored procedures to run as modern applications within a graphic user interface, or GUI.
PROC, a procedural language used by Multi-Value / Pick based systems, similar to unix shell scripts or windows batch files, consist of terse, macro commands. PROC's are widely used to accept operator input, and drive reports or front-end basic programs and generally lack security, user-friendly features or a modern appearance.
A revolutionary procedure from Binary Star (as yet un-named) is able to convert complex multi-field PROC's to run as a modern applications, with pop-up selection lists, sophisticated validations and interactive help in a secure environment providing meaningful operator feed-back and a choice of report outputs including display, print, print-to-file, fax, HTML, Excel and others.
According to Lee Bacall, the President of Binary Star, the ability to automatically generate pop-up choices from PROC-styled T,(column,row) references, adding real validations, and converting multi-IF statements and UO1AD user exits is seen as a break-through in enabling Multi-Value systems to finally be viewed as modern applications.
Converted PROC's can now run as either GUI applications or graphic character applications within the Nucleus framework, according to Binary Star sources.
